Output b80567878103d8c2afde3f642011c639d52d7eab91d4062861f173268f0a98f3:104

value
374471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9653a3637a2678a37494d496654f5c3524252d OP_EQUAL
address
3Egwxfd7e5uWHPa99oRCnQs6KcQQrj6atp
transaction
b80567878103d8c2afde3f642011c639d52d7eab91d4062861f173268f0a98f3
confirmations
174270
spent
true